The mass of the precipitate formed as a result of the interaction of 5.2 g of barium chloride with an acid solution in excess is …

Given:
m (BaCl2) = 5.2 g
To find:
m (BaSO4)
Decision:
BaCl2 + H2SO4 = BaSO4 + 2HCl
n (BaCl2) = m / M = 5.2 g / 208 g / mol = 0.025 mol
n (BaCl2): n (BaSO4) = 1: 1
n (BaSO4) = 0.025 mol
m (BaSO4) = n * M = 0.025 mol * 233 g / mol = 5.825 g
Answer: 5.825 g
